Post by: radu81 on July 26, 2016, 05:09:39 pm
I suggest you to use it othewise you will have lots of inexistent email address (or bounced address). If you send a newsletter or announce a topic you will send it to inexistent emails and that's not a good practice for the reputation of your domain. in few words, more bounce=less reputation=emails not delivered or marked as spam

I did the same thing on my forum, no activation during registration and I had to clean/delete the bounced and unused accounts manually
